Bill got 60% off a new jacket. He ended up spending $18. What was the original price of jacket?

Answer:

45

Step-by-step explanation:

first create a proportion.

40/100 = 18/x

you're trying to find x, the original price, so to find x you'll need to cross multiply. 18 times 100 divided by 40, which is 45.

The original price was $45
